pub struct MetadataCache {
pub applied_index: u64,
pub last_applied_hlc: Hlc,
pub leases: HashMap<(DescriptorId, u64), DescriptorLease>,
pub topology_log: Vec<TopologyChange>,
pub routing_log: Vec<RoutingChange>,
pub cluster_version: u16,
pub catalog_entries_applied: u64,
}Expand description
In-memory view of the committed metadata state.
Fields§
§applied_index: u64§last_applied_hlc: Hlc§leases: HashMap<(DescriptorId, u64), DescriptorLease>(descriptor_id, node_id) -> lease.
topology_log: Vec<TopologyChange>Topology mutations applied so far.
routing_log: Vec<RoutingChange>§cluster_version: u16§catalog_entries_applied: u64Monotonically-increasing count of committed CatalogDdl
entries. Exposed for tests and metrics — planners read
catalog state through the host-side SystemCatalog, not
this counter.
